N08031 Stainless Steel vs. EN 2.4663 Nickel

N08031 stainless steel belongs to the iron alloys classification, while EN 2.4663 nickel belongs to the nickel alloys. They have 60% of their average alloy composition in common. There are 28 material properties with values for both materials. Properties with values for just one material (4, in this case) are not shown.

For each property being compared, the top bar is N08031 stainless steel and the bottom bar is EN 2.4663 nickel.
